The lipkit mogul started the video looking gorgeous and totally makeup free. Although she's young, Kylie knows that moisturizing your skin and lips is key to making sure your makeup doesn't end up looking cakey or creases around your wrinkles and fine lines.

The next step is slaying those eyebrows.

Kylie goes in with a brow pencil to shape them to her liking and then perfects it with a bit of concealer and small brush for precision. OK, so this other mega tip Kylie shared is rather important. The reality TV star revealed she always does her eye makeup before applying foundation. The reason for that is in case any residue from the eyeshadow falls on her face, she can just remove it with a wipe.

The most important part of foundation is blending.

Kylie said she likes to keep it light with her foundation so that her freckles show through. She also suggested blending with a sponge and bringing the makeup down to your neck to avoid having two different tones. Also, check out that adorable gold "Baby mama" necklace she's wearing.

Remember, concealer comes AFTER foundation.

Once you apply foundation, then you can use concealer to hide any imperfections or to highlight certain areas of your face. It might look silly during the process but it will pay off in the end. After applying mascara to her lashes, the Keeping Up With the Kardashians star finished off the look with tons of blush and a dash of highlighter. She said she loves the Barely Legal blush from her own cosmetics line so much, that she ended up applying it to most of her face.
